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next v6 3/5] net: ti: icssg-prueth: Add support for HSR frame forward offload
Date: Wed, 11 Sep 2024 14:55:49 +0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<61611bc5-6a4c-4c4b-9088-b0f00c4894a2@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240911081603.2521729-4-danishanwar@ti.com>



On 11/09/2024 11:16, MD Danish Anwar wrote:
> Add support for offloading HSR port-to-port frame forward to hardware.
> When the slave interfaces are added to the HSR interface, the PRU cores
> will be stopped and ICSSG HSR firmwares will be loaded to them.
> 
> Similarly, when HSR interface is deleted, the PRU cores will be
> restarted and the last used firmwares will be reloaded. PRUeth
> interfaces will be back to the last used mode.
> 
> This commit also renames some APIs that are common between switch and
> hsr mode with '_fw_offload' suffix.
